Is it possible to make the Players` hands visible in first person,If so,Can someone make an add-on for that?

Weapons can have a fake hand that can only be one color. Badspot could enable hand visibility in first person, or Port can probably work his coding magic although the chances of enabling it without Badspot's help is very low.

I think you can color hands on items with the correct player hand color like the speedkarts do but I'm not sure if you can use the same technique used on vehicles on items.

You can only color players, items, vehicles, shapes (and possibly a few others - I'm tired). The only way to color an image is skinTags, which require premade texture files for each unique color tag.
